A Book/Disk Introduction To Creating Programs That Allow Computers To Adapt To Unexpected Events. Covers Basic Theory Of Genetic Algorithms (Gas); Common Evolutionary Programming Techniques; Finite State Machines; And Optimization Of Input Values Through Natural Selection. Includes Code Examples Demonstrating Ga Theory, Common Dynamic Models, And Representations Of Biological Evolution. Assumes Some Programming Experience. The Accompanying Disk Contains Source Code.
